Dropbox keeps crashing and restarting itself in an infinite crash loop

Since yesterday, Dropbox is stuck in a crash/restart loop, I'm on Mac OS Mojave. I tried: Installed the last stable version and still in the crash loop. Installed the last beta version and still in the crash loop. Deleted the Dropbox application and re-install - still the same results. I opened console - the last message Dropbox sends before the icon vanishes is: "Too many groups requested (2147483647). Can cause performance issues when network directories are involved" Anyone has any good idea how to solve?
